Introduction to Pneumatic Conveying of Solids

Pneumatic conveying is the movement of solids through pipe using gas (usually air) as the motive force. It differs from hydraulic or slurry conveying in that the gas expands continuously along the pipe length. Pneumatic Conveying

Both standard and fragile powders can be transported using pneumatic conveying systems. These systems are normally divided into four types depending on whether the material is blown or vacuumed through the pipe, and if the solids-to-air ratio is high (dense phase) or low (dilute phase). An Overview of Pneumatic Conveying Systems and …

1.1 Introduction. Pneumatic conveying involves the transportation of a wide variety of dry powdered and granular solids in a gas stream. In most cases the gas is normally air. However, where special conditions prevail (e.g. risk of explosion, health, fire hazards, etc.), different gases are used.
